Microsoft Power Automate is a workflow automation service that combines cloud based flows, desktop robotic process automation, and AI capabilities. Cloud flows connect apps and services to move data and trigger actions automatically, while desktop flows record and replay interactions with legacy and web applications. AI features add document processing and agent style automation to handle less structured work. As part of the Power Platform, it integrates tightly with Microsoft 365, Dynamics, and hundreds of connectors so users can automate tasks across many business tools.
The service is aimed at business users, IT teams, and organizations already using Microsoft products who want to automate repetitive tasks without heavy development. It suits people automating approvals, notifications, data syncing, and document workflows, as well as teams building attended and unattended RPA bots. Its low code designer makes it approachable for non developers, while pro developers can extend flows with custom connectors and expressions. Enterprises use it for governed, organization wide automation that spans both modern cloud apps and older desktop software.
In practice, users build flows from triggers and actions, connect them to apps through connectors, and let them run automatically or on a schedule. Desktop flows automate screen based tasks, and AI models extract data from documents. Central administration handles monitoring, security, and sharing across the organization.
